In case you are not aware, you can freely download and install Windows and activate it at a later time. Until then you will only miss desktop customization and will have a watermark on it.
By not paying nkw for Windows and a few more compromises on other parts, you may even squeeze a 5080 in a 3k euros budget, though it is a big overkill for 1440p.

Overkill I meant going for a 5080 GPU instead of a 5070 Ti.
If you care for just gaming, you can save a good chunk of cash by replacing the RTX 5070 Ti GPU with an RX 9070 XT.
However my biggest concern about AMD cards is stability, because for almost a year now and especially lately Reddit is full of complains about driver timeouts and crashes in Windows.
They also have way less industry support and I read many people doing lots of settings fiddling and using 3rd party apps for stuff that Nvidia cards do better, easier and natively.
If these things are important enough for you to stick with Nvidia cards but you still want to save money, you can replace the 5070 Ti with the plain 5070. It's a fine 1400p and decent entry-level 4k card, but you will need to dial gfx settings down in very demanding games, especially Path Tracing settings (btw PT is a big struggle for the 9070 XT too). The 5070 Ti is way better in PT.
